自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 Ubuntu9.04下配置ftp

在Ubuntu9.4下配置ftp服务,我用的是最常用的vsftpd。首先,在线安装vsftpd:(以下都是在root权限下操作) # apt-get install vsftpd 执行成功后,会在home下生成ftp账户:/home/ftp. 然后,修改/etc/vsftpd.conf: #独立模式启动 *listen=YES#验证方式 *p...

2009-08-20 12:08:01 136

原创 php图片验证码

      php里图片验证码的实现的大概思路是:生成随机验证码,把验证码写到session中,生成图片,把验证码写到图片上,输出图片。      下面是从网上找来的一段生成验证码图片的类verify.php:<?phpsession_start();session_register("login_check_number");//如果浏览器显示“图像XXX因其本身有错无...

2009-08-18 20:30:59 135

ThinkPHP静态缓存简单配置和使用

根据ThinkPHP官方手册:ThinkPHP内置了静态缓存类,通过静态缓存规则定义来实现了可配置的静态缓存。启用静态缓存:  ThinkPHP官方手册写道要使用静态缓存功能,需要开启HTML_CACHE_ON 参数,并且在项目配置目录下面增加静态缓存规则文件 htmls.php,两者缺一不可。否则静态缓存不会生效。  在配置文件Conf\config....

2009-08-17 23:41:13 100

thinkphp验证码的使用

      在thinkphp中使用验证码很容易,只要调用thinkphp现有的方法就可以。当然,php的GD库肯定是要开的。首先,在写Action文件,如:IndexAction.class.php.<?phpclass IndexAction extends Action{ //显示验证码 public function verifyTest() { $thi...

2009-08-17 22:20:05 304

原创 在xp中安装配置ruby on rails

1. 安装ruby:     在ruby官方网站或ruby中文网站下载最新的ruby版本。我使用的是Ruby 1.8.6 一步安装版。下载完成后和普通exe程序一样双击安装。安装成功后可在命令行输入“ruby -v”查看当前安装版本。2. 安装rails:     在命令行下进入ruby的安装目录,比如:E:/ruby>,输入:gem instal...

2009-08-16 19:35:31 137

原创 checkbox的全选与取消

checkbox的全选与取消肯定有不同的方法,本文介绍的方法的关键点在于:checkbox组的名字相同,点击控制全选的checkbox时调用js,使checkbox组的checked属性与控制全选的checkbox的checked属性保持一致。 <script type='text/javascript'> function selectAll(e) { //返...

2009-07-15 21:23:54 439

留言表情的简单实现

      留言或回复时常常会用到类似QQ表情之类的效果,但是要想在textarea里面显示图片有一定的困难。我参考网上的资料做了这个简单的表情的添加和显示。      思路是:点击表情图片时,用javascript得到图片的名称并添加到textarea的内容里,php文件得到表单传递过的内容后利用str_replace()函数把分隔符替换相应的html标记。实现如下: guestbo...

2009-07-12 00:32:56 440

一个不错的日期控件:My97DatePicker

个人觉得My97DatePicker是一个不错的日期控件,没有研究太多,日前只用到了平面显示和在input中单击的调用。 平面显示: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"&g...

2009-07-08 00:22:52 105

原创 2009年中国Facebook开发者大会

由China Social Apps Developer和JavaEye网站共同主办的中国Facebook应用开发者大会于2009年6月27日下午在上海福州路318号高腾大厦24层 M1NT酒吧举行,活动由Facebook和Intel赞助,活动现场有免费的饮料和甜点,会后还发放了纪念T-shirt。    大会现场相当火爆,有二三百人的样子,我到的时候已经没有位置可坐了,很多人只能站在吧台边上。下...

2009-06-27 22:47:24 264

in_array学习

in_array : 检查数组中是否存在某个值。Manual中给出的语法是:bool in_array ( mixed $needle , array $haystack [, bool $strict ] )意思是在 haystack 中搜索 needle ,如果找到则返回 TRUE,否则返回 FALSE。 如果第三个参数 strict 的...

2009-06-24 22:18:58 108

php和smarty中格式化输出日期和时间的比较

php中格式化输出日期和时间可用:date('Y-m-d H:i:s',时间戳);的形式输出,对应的是“年-月-日 时:分:秒”。而在smarty模板中,如$time是php文件中assign过来的时间戳,在模板文件中写法为:<{$time|date_format:'%Y-%m-%d %H:%M:%S'}>,同样对应的输出格式为:“年-月-日 时:分:秒”。 p...

2009-06-23 22:34:22 350

利用JQuery制作简单二级联动

刚开始学jquery,试着用jquery做了一个小例子:省市的二级联动。 在数据库test中建表province和city。province有字段id和name。city表中字段是id,city_name和province_id。 view部分代码如下: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ional...

2009-06-22 21:40:34 232

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除